Research Content

Drawing on the potential strength of the microbial communities, we develop environmentally friendly and cost-saving innovative wastewater and waste treatment systems, which are then piloted on a large scale for industrial application. Besides, with sophisticated and advanced molecular microbiology techniques, we conduct in-depth studies on the microorganism, including analyzing microbial communities, isolating and culturing uncultured microorganisms, and clarifying species interactions. Recently, pioneering hydrosphere soil environmental control technologies are becoming a new research direction in our lab. It involves studies on agricultural biomass recycling, water reclamation systems implementation for terrestrial aquaculture, and plant disease treatment by biological methods.

A Day in the Lab

Overall, we work on the spirit of independence, self-discipline, and creativity. In other words, we are always motivated to work towards goals but based on self-time management. Besides, thanks to a dense network of cooperation with many institutions, universities, and companies in Japan and abroad, lab members have many opportunities to attend domestic and international conferences or job fairs to keep up with novel waste treatment technologies and expand career opportunities. Outside of research, many parties and extracurricular activities are organized to make the relationship among laboratory members close-knit.

Thesis Subjects

  • (M)Isolution, cultivation, and characterization of MBR biofilm-forming bacteria by in-situ cultivation
  • (M)Development of a plant disease control method using soil microorganisms
  • (D)Development of bioreactors for methane-driven nitrogen removal in anaerobic wastewater treatment
